Posted: Wed, 12th Jul 2006 10:10 Post subject: |
|
 |
I don't know what was hiding behind Gabe Newell words, but he said that theft is the reason for a 4 month delay.
http://money.cnn.com/2003/10/07/commentary/game_over/column_gaming/
Quote: |
It's the latest in a series of frustrations for Vivendi Universal Games (V: Research, Estimates) and developer Valve. Earlier today, Christophe Ramboz, VU Games president of international operations, told Reuters the source code theft would result in a four month delay, pushing Half-Life 2 back to April 2004.
